Tea is usually seen as a drink that gives energy and refreshment in the morning and afternoon when you’re feeling tired and need energy. But tea can also be a gentle way of giving your body rest and ensuring a good night’s sleep. Here’s how:
Herbal teas have natural calming properties
Herbal teas like chamomile, valerian root and lavender are made from dried flowers, herbs and roots. These ingredients have healing properties that interact with the nervous system to promote calmness and reduce stress. Herbal teas contain antioxidants that relax the body, reduce heart rate and encourage sleepiness. So if you’re wishing for a peaceful sleep, have some herbal tea.

Little to no caffeine options
One of the primary reason why tea supports sleep is because it contains very little or, in some types, no caffeine at all. Certain herbal teas such as chamomile and peppermint won’t keep you awake. Caffeine must be avoided at night as even little amount of it can prevent you from falling asleep faster. That makes tea an excellent choice as a drink after dinner.
Supports digestive comfort
Poor digestion and things like bloating, acidity and gas will surely not let you sleep at night. But tea can help you with these problems. They can relieve the gas, relax digestive muscles and reduce acid reflux. With a good gut, you can feel lighter and enjoy your sleep.
